  • Patent number: 5145239
    Abstract: A known brake circuit comprises a mechanical brake-pressure control device and an electrical brake-pressure control device. The mechanical brake-pressure control device is furnished for assuring an emergency operation in case of a fault of the normally predominance-taking electrical brake-pressure control device. The known brake circuit can be controlled only then in a load-dependent way, when both the mechanical as well as the electrical brake-pressure control unit comprise a load-dependent automatic brake-pressure controller. According to the invention, a restraining device (103 3, 5) is furnished in the mechanical brake-prerssure control device (103 3, 5). The restraining device (3) allows for passage of the brake pressure, set in the mechanical brake-pressure control device (103 3, 5), only in case of a fault in the electrical brake-pressure control device (106 6, 9, 12, 13).

  • Patent number: 4408967
    Abstract: A piston cylinder and head arrangement for compressors including a valve plate disposed between a piston housing and the head. An intake valve, a discharge valve, and an atmospheric vent valve are all operably disposed in the valve plate, and are all arranged relative to each other and relative to an intake chamber, a compression chamber, and cooling chambers so as to necessitate only one sealing gasket for sealing said valves and said chambers from each other during certain operational phases of the compressor. The arrangement further includes a piston operable responsively to discharge pressure in excess of a certain high degree for diverting such pressure output from the pressure discharge valve to the atmospheric vent valve until such pressure drops below the certain high degree.

  • Patent number: 4395442
    Abstract: A method of protecting the frictional engaging surfaces of an aluminum alloy piston-cylinder machine, including the steps of: coating the surface of one of the piston-cylinder members with an epoxy-resin in which is mixed a ceramic oxide material, placing the coated member in a drier oven, and heating and curing the epoxy-resin and ceramic oxide coating for at least one hour at a temperature of approximately 220.degree. C.
